How to approach Reading Test Part Six
• This part of the Reading Test tests your ability to identify additional or unnecessary words in a text.
• Most lines contain one extra word that makes the sentence incorrect.
• Read the whole text quickly to find out what it is about. As you read, try to identify the words that are incorrect.
• Then read the text again, and write down the extra words. Remember there will be only one extra word in a line, and some lines are correct.
• Read the article below about a chain of cafes.
• In most lines there is one unnecessary word. It is either grammatically incorrect or does not fit in with the sense of the text. Some lines are correct.
• For each numbered line 41 - 52, find the unnecessary word and then write the word in CAPITAL LETTERS on your Answer Sheet.
